Frequently Asked Questions

What is the CareGrader rating for Grants Wellness & Rehabilitation LLC?

Grants Wellness & Rehabilitation LLC in Grants, New Mexico has a CareGrader grade of C (Average), with a composite score of 76 out of 100. This grade is based on health inspections, staffing levels, quality measures, and penalty history from official CMS government data.

What is the CMS star rating for Grants Wellness & Rehabilitation LLC?

Grants Wellness & Rehabilitation LLC has an overall CMS star rating of 5 out of 5, a health inspection rating of 4/5, and a staffing rating of 3/5. CareGrader combines this with additional data to calculate an A-F grade.

How many health deficiencies does Grants Wellness & Rehabilitation LLC have?

Grants Wellness & Rehabilitation LLC has 22 health deficiencies on record from CMS health inspection surveys. Deficiencies are rated from A (minimal harm potential) to L (immediate jeopardy, widespread). View the full inspection timeline above for details on each deficiency.

Has Grants Wellness & Rehabilitation LLC been fined?

Yes. Grants Wellness & Rehabilitation LLC has $56,641 in total fines from CMS enforcement actions across 3 penalties.

How many beds does Grants Wellness & Rehabilitation LLC have?

Grants Wellness & Rehabilitation LLC has 80 certified beds with approximately 61 current residents (76% occupancy). The facility is located at 840 Lobo Canyon Road, Grants, New Mexico 87020. It is a non profit - corporation facility.

Data Disclaimer

Inspection data, staffing levels, and star ratings are sourced from CMS Medicare Nursing Home Compare and are largely self-reported by facilities. A 2019 GAO study found that 43% of facilities under-reported falls. CareGrader provides this data for informational purposes only and is not affiliated with CMS or Medicare. Always visit facilities in person before making a decision.
